> > I have just modified the /etc/init.d/inetsvc script to be
> >
> > /usr/local/sbin/named ...etc
> >
> > However the named daemon fails to run as it complains about
> the libcrypto.so 0.9.6:open failed; no such file or directory.
> >
> > If I run this daemon as root user then it works, because i
> have the LD_LIBRARY_PATH variable set, how can I get this to
> run from the init.d directory?
>
> In /etc/init.d/inetsvc, replace this:
>
> /usr/local/sbin/named
>
> with this:
>
> (LD_LIBRARY_PATH=...; export LD_LIBRARY_PATH;
> /usr/local/sbin/named)
> Of course, put the path you use in place of "...".
>
> The parentheses isolate this one invocation; then
> $LD_LIBRARY_PATH will
> not be set for all the other programs running from 'inetsvc'.
